Significant reduction of false positives for C, C++ and Objective-C path sensitive rules

Hello dear C, C++ and Objective-C users

We are very happy to bring you some significant improvements on the front of path-sensitive rules (lists for C, C++, Objective-C).
We significantly lowered the false-positive rate in the issues we raise for these rules.
We achieved that by both:

  • Improving the modeling in our engine
  • Taking asserts as hints, even in Release builds.

This also comes with a series of bug fixes and other improvements. The entire list is available here.

These will be available with SonarQube 9.7 and it is already available on SonarCloud .

Cheers

1 Like